EDITORS COMMENTS
This print showcases a meticulous reconstruction of the ancient Assyrian city of Dur Sharrukin, now known as modern-day Khorsabad. The image offers a glimpse into the grandeur and architectural marvels that once defined this historical site. At its center stands the imposing citadel and palace of Sargon II, exuding power and authority. The attention to detail in this depiction is truly remarkable. Every element has been carefully crafted, from the intricate streets winding through the city to the majestic ziggurat towering above all else at the top center of the image. This ziggurat serves as a testament to Assyrian religious practices and their reverence for deities. As we explore this visual representation, we are transported back in time to an era when ancient civilizations thrived. The model provides us with an invaluable insight into how life might have looked within these walls centuries ago. It allows us to appreciate not only their advanced architecture but also their sophisticated urban planning.
